On Monday, December 23, 2024, Calvin Eugene Griffis was suddenly called home to glory. He was born on September 24, 1965, to Zilla Griffis.
Calvin was a lifelong resident of Newport News. He was educated in the Newport News Public School system and graduated from Denbigh High School. He was employed as a roofer until his health prevented him from working.
Calvin was a die-hard fan of the Pittsburgh Steelers football team. He loved the song “Take Me To The King” by Tamela Mann, and his favorite scripture was John 3:16.
He was the protector of his family and friends, who were his greatest loves. Calvin would do anything for anybody and would give the shirt off of his back to anyone in need. He will be greatly missed by all who knew him.
Calvin is preceded in death by his mother; sisters, Regina Martin, Clareitha Griffis, and April Griffis; and brother Elvis Martin.
He leaves cherished memories with his son Dominic D’Amico; bonus sons, George Sheppard and Aaron Harris; bonus daughters, Marketta Harris and Nikiya Sheppard; devoted sister Vanessa Graves (Thomas); brothers, Albert Griffis (Angela), Terry Griffis, and Elmer Griffis; aunt Marie Dammons; loving and devoted friend Sharon Harris; best friends, Johnathan Edwards and Michael Collins; nieces, Minister Tanisha Tyler-Graves (Bobby), Vanessa Tyler Crew (Dennis), Leticia Griffis, Ashante Griffis, Cierra Pleasant, Noelle McClarin, Serena Griffis, and Apryl Griffis; nephews, Carlos Martin, Laroy Griffis, Charles Griffis, Elmer Griffis III, De Angelo Griffis, Trey Griffis, and Terry Griffis, Jr.; beloved bonus grandchildren, Deonna Harris and Adonis Harris; special cousin James Wynn (Donna); and a host of other loving relatives and friends.
